    I started a new thread to get away from the one dated 2016.

    St. Louis is joining MLS and will start play in 2022.

    https://www.mlssoccer.com/post/2019/08/20/mls-awards-expansion-team-st-louis

    They will be team #28.

    Just to recap, (25) Miami and (26) Nashville start play in 2020. (27)Austin is on the schedule for 2021.

    Earlier this year MLS said that they are expanding to 30 teams but no timetable was given. Sacramento is believed to be the leading candidate for #29.
